
Real Estate Investment in Chile: Legal and Tax Guide for Individuals and Companies
Santiago, Chile – May 28, 2025 – Investing in Chilean real estate requires understanding the legal and tax implications, according to Giorgio Cervellino, a lawyer specializing in real estate and property taxation. In an interview on La Metro's "Metro Cuadrado" radio program, Cervellino highlighted key considerations for both individual and corporate investors. "For a purchase, you must distinguish whether you're acting as an individual or a company," he explained. He emphasized the importance of understanding tax implications, noting benefits for owning two properties with FL2 characteristics, while a third property triggers annual income reporting requirements. The show also discussed the advantages and disadvantages of forming a company for real estate investment, offering a balanced perspective for potential investors.
